DEPARTMENT OF ENERGY
REDELEGATION ORDER NO. 00-002.06
TO THE DIRECTOR, OFFICE OF CIVILIAN
RADIOACTIVE WASTE MANAGEMENT
1. DELEGATION. Pursuant to section 202(b) of the Department of Energy Organization
Act (Public Law 95-91, 42 U.S.C. 7132(b)) and Secretary of Energy Delegation Order
00-022 provided to the Under Secretary for Energy, Science and Environment to perform
the function and duties related to Civilian Radioactive Waste Management, I delegate to
the Director, Office of Civilian Radioactive Waste Management authority to take the
following actions:
1.1 Sign all documents and take such other actions as may be necessary and
appropriate for the submission for publication to the Federal Register of notices
concerning actions undertaken to implement the authorities and functions
provided in the Nuclear Waste Policy Act of 1982 (Public Law 97-425). The
authority delegated does not include rulemaking authority.
1.2 Report and transmit, on a semi-annual basis, site characterization progress reports
for the Yucca Mountain site in the State of Nevada to the Nuclear Regulatory
Commission, the Governor and the legislature of the State of Nevada, and other
interested parties including the United States Congress. The reports are required
under section 113(b)(3) of the Nuclear Waste Policy Act of 1982, as amended
(Public Law 97-425, as amended by Title V, Subtitle A, of Public Law 100-203).
Any such report, which is issued by the Director pursuant to this Order, must be
submitted for concurrence by the General Counsel, the Assistant Secretary for
Congressional and Intergovernmental Affairs, and the Under Secretary for
Energy, Science, and Environment prior to its transmittal to the Nuclear
Regulatory Commission, the Governor and the legislature of the State of Nevada,
Congress, and other interested parties.
Each such report will be submitted to the Office of the Secretary at least one week
prior to transmittal to the Nuclear Regulatory Commission, the Governor and the
legislature of the State of Nevada.
1.3 Establish, alter, consolidate or discontinue such organizational units or
components within assigned organizational elements as deemed to be necessary
or appropriate.
A. In exercising this authority, or as redelegated pursuant thereto, delegates
will be limited by approved budgets, staffing level allocations, and Senior
Executive Service and other executive resource position allocations.
Organizational changes shall not be announced or implemented until
appropriate union coordination and other pre-release clearances have been
obtained.

B. This authority does not include approval of additional, deletion, or transfer
of mission and functions of or between Departmental Headquarters or
Field Elemetd, which authority is reserved to the Secretary.
C. Heads of Departmental Headquarters may delegate the authority to alter or
consolidate organizational elements further, in whole or in part, consistent
with the terms of the Department of Energy Organization Act, to an
official or officials one level below the Head of the Departmental
Headquarters.
D. The authority to establish or discontinue organizational elements at the
first or second level below the Departmental Headquarters may not be
redelegated.

E. Acting Heads of Departmental Headquarters may not redelegate these
authorities and may only establish, alter, consolidate or discontinue
organizational units at the third level and below. During the tenure of an
acting Head of a Departmental Headquarters, organizational units below
the Head of Departmental Headquarters may not exercise redelegations
granting the authority to alter or consolidate units.
2. RESCISSION. Delegation Orders 0204-116, 0204-137, 0204-152, and 0204-153 are
hereby rescinded.
3. LIMITATION.
3.1 In exercising the authority delegated in this Order, a delegate shall be governed
by the rules and regulations of the Department of Energy and the policies and
procedures prescribed by the Secretary or delegate(s).
3.2 Nothing in this Order precludes the Secretary or the Under Secretary for Energy,
Science and Environment from exercising any of the authority delegated by this
Order.
3.3 Any amendments to this Order shall be in consultation with the Department of
Energy General Counsel.
4. AUTHORITY TO REDELEGATE.
4.1 Except as expressly prohibited by law, regulation, or this Order, the Director,
Office of Civilian Radioactive Waste Management may delegate this authority
further, in whole or in part.

4.2 Copies of redelegations and any subsequent redelegations shall be provided to the
Office of Management and Operations Support, which manages the Secretarial
Delegations of Authority system.
5. DURATION AND EFFECTIVE DATE.
5.1 All actions pursuant to any authority delegated prior to this Order or pursuant to
any authority delegated by this Order taken prior to and in effect on the date of
this Order are ratified and remain in force as if taken under this Order, unless or
until rescinded, amended or superseded.
5.2 This Order is effective January 8, 2002.
